New Job Opportunity – Quality Lineside Engineer (Onsite, Broughton, UK)

Job Overview

An exciting contract opportunity has arisen for a Quality Engineer (Lineside) to join a client’s Quality team based onsite in Broughton. The role sits at the heart of a high‑volume manufacturing environment, where quality, safety and customer focus are critical. Your key responsibilities will include assuring product and process conformity, supporting operational teams and driving corrective and preventative actions.

Key Responsibilities
  • Providing specialist quality support and advice on drawings, parts, processes and support services
  • Independently assuring that quality requirements are met
  • Conducting surveillance activities to ensure adherence to the quality management system
  • Ensuring certification processes are clearly defined and consistently applied
  • Coordinating and leading quality and technical issue resolution using multifunctional teams
  • Performing initial investigations into non‑conformances, events and quality issues to identify root cause
  • Driving corrective and preventative actions through structured problem‑solving techniques
  • Investigating deficiencies identified during process confirmation activities
  • Compiling and presenting quality performance overviews to local leadership teams
Requirements – Essential
  • Quality background within a large, complex manufacturing organisation
  • Ability to interpret engineering drawings
  • Strong problem‑solving skills using tools such as 5 Whys, Ishikawa and PPS
  • Confident communication skills with the ability to challenge constructively
  • Data analysis skills with the ability to interpret trends and draw conclusions
  • Strong team‑working capability within cross‑functional environments
Requirements – Desirable
  • Experience in aerospace, automotive or similar regulated industries
Working Pattern

This is an onsite role based in Broughton, UK. The role will operate on a double‑day shift pattern (alternating weeks).

What's in it for you
  • £32.96 per hour Umbrella OR £24.64 per hour PAYE
  • 20% shift uplift
  • Contract running until November 2026, with potential extension
  • Overtime paid at enhanced rates beyond 35 hours
